Specifications and Technologies
The guide outlines the specifications of pressure sensors, which include pressure ranges from draft to 100,000 PSI and output options such as millivolt, voltage, analog, and digital. It describes the use of different sensing technologies like bonded foil strain gage, silicon piezoresistive, ceramic, and variable capacitance to cater to diverse applications.

Technical Specifications
The devices provide a full-scale output of 3 mV/V and 4-20 mA, with nominal input voltages of 10 Vdc and 16-30 Vdc. Accuracy is maintained at ≤ ± 0.50% and ≤ ± 0.60% for different models. Standard pressure connections include 3/4” – 16 UNF – 2B and 1/4” NPT Female, with wetted parts made from Inconel 718 and 316L SST.

Additional Features and Benefits
The devices are designed with spike resistance, high cycle life, stainless steel construction, and external zero adjust. They are available in various pressure ranges, including 0-5 thru 0-15,000 psig and 0-0.35 thru 0-1,000 barg.
Standard Ranges
Pressure ranges are available in psi, bar, MPa, and kgf/cm², supporting standard bar ranges from 0-0.7 thru 0-7 bara and 0-1 barv.
